Yapay Zeka Destekli Web Geliştirme: AI ile Laravel Projelerinde Verimlilik Artırma

Yapay Zeka Destekli Web Geliştirme: AI ile Laravel Projelerinde Verimlilik Artırma

---

Al_Yapay_Zeka

---

Web geliştirme dünyasında her geçen gün yeni teknolojiler ve araçlar hayatımıza girmeye devam ediyor. Bu teknolojilerden biri de, son yıllarda büyük bir hızla popülerlik kazanan yapay zeka (AI). Peki, AI'yi mevcut projelerimize nasıl entegre edebiliriz? Bu yazıda, Laravel framework'ü kullanarak geliştirdiğiniz projelere yapay zeka desteği ekleyerek, verimliliğinizi nasıl artırabileceğinizi keşfedeceksiniz.

AI ve Laravel Entegrasyonu Nedir?

Laravel, PHP tabanlı güçlü bir framework olup, web geliştirme dünyasında oldukça yaygın olarak kullanılıyor. Laravel ile geliştirilmiş projelerde yapay zeka entegrasyonu, size bir dizi avantaj sunar. AI, projelerinizin daha akıllı hale gelmesini sağlar. Özellikle veri analitiği, hata tespiti ve müşteri desteği gibi alanlarda büyük farklar yaratabilir. Laravel ile AI entegrasyonunun avantajlarından biri, Laravel’in esnek yapısı sayesinde AI araçlarını kolayca projelerinize dahil edebilmenizdir.

Yapay Zeka ile Otomatik Hata Tespiti ve Çözümü

Hata ayıklama, yazılım geliştirme sürecinin zorlu ve zaman alıcı bir kısmıdır. Ancak AI, bu süreci çok daha hızlı ve verimli hale getirebilir. Yapay zeka algoritmaları, kodunuzda oluşabilecek hataları önceden tespit edip, potansiyel sorunları size bildirerek çözüm önerileri sunar. Bu sayede, geliştirme süreciniz hızlanır ve daha az hata yaparak sağlam bir kod ortaya koyarsınız.

Örnek olarak, yapay zeka destekli hata tespit araçları, Laravel projelerinizdeki syntax hatalarını, yanlış parametre kullanımlarını veya güvenlik açıklarını hızla tespit edebilir. Bu tür araçlar, geliştirme sürecindeki zaman kayıplarını en aza indirir.


use AI\ErrorDetection;

$errorDetector = new ErrorDetection();
$errors = $errorDetector->analyzeCode($code);
if (!empty($errors)) {
    // Hatalar bildiriliyor
    foreach ($errors as $error) {
        echo "Error: " . $error;
    }
}


Yapay Zeka Destekli Veri Analitiği ve Raporlama

Web projelerinin başarısını ölçmek ve iyileştirmek için doğru verilere sahip olmak oldukça önemlidir. Yapay zeka, projelerinizdeki verileri analiz eder ve anlamlı raporlar oluşturur. Laravel projelerinde veri analitiği yaparken AI kullanmak, verilerinizi daha derinlemesine anlamanızı sağlar.

AI tabanlı veri analiz araçları, kullanıcı davranışlarını takip eder, hangi özelliklerin daha fazla kullanıldığını analiz eder ve buna göre raporlar oluşturur. Bu veriler sayesinde, web sitenizin performansını artırmak için daha doğru kararlar verebilirsiniz.


use AI\DataAnalytics;

$analytics = new DataAnalytics();
$report = $analytics->generateReport($data);
echo $report;


Laravel Projelerinde AI ile Performans İyileştirmeleri

Web uygulamalarının hızını artırmak, her zaman geliştiriciler için önemli bir hedef olmuştur. Yapay zeka, performans iyileştirme süreçlerinde önemli bir rol oynar. Laravel projelerinde AI kullanarak, uygulamanızın yükleme hızını optimize edebilir, kaynak kullanımını verimli hale getirebilirsiniz.

AI, trafik yoğunluğuna göre otomatik olarak sunucu kaynaklarını yönetebilir, gereksiz veri işlemlerini azaltabilir ve kullanıcı deneyimini iyileştirebilir. Böylece, Laravel projelerinizde daha hızlı ve verimli bir web uygulaması sunabilirsiniz.

Yapay Zeka Tabanlı Chatbotlar ve Müşteri Destek Çözümleri

Birçok web uygulaması, kullanıcılarının sorularını yanıtlamak veya problemlerini çözmek için chatbot kullanmaktadır. Yapay zeka destekli chatbotlar, kullanıcılara hızlı ve doğru çözümler sunarak müşteri desteğini büyük ölçüde iyileştirir. Laravel projelerinde bu chatbotları entegre etmek oldukça basittir. AI, her geçen gün daha akıllı hale gelerek, müşteri destek süreçlerini otomatikleştirir ve kullanıcıların sorunlarını çözme süresini kısaltır.

Yapay zeka chatbotları, sadece sıkça sorulan soruları yanıtlamakla kalmaz, aynı zamanda kullanıcı davranışlarını analiz ederek daha kişiselleştirilmiş deneyimler sunar. Bu, kullanıcı memnuniyetini artırırken, aynı zamanda işletmenizin verimliliğini de artırır.


use AI\Chatbot;

$chatbot = new Chatbot();
$chatbot->setResponse($userQuery);
$response = $chatbot->generateResponse();
echo $response;


Sonuç: Laravel Projelerinde Yapay Zeka ile Verimlilik Artırma

Laravel projelerinde yapay zeka kullanmak, yalnızca geliştirme sürecinizi hızlandırmakla kalmaz, aynı zamanda kullanıcı deneyimini de büyük ölçüde iyileştirir. AI, otomatik hata tespiti, veri analitiği, performans iyileştirme ve chatbotlar gibi birçok alanda size yardımcı olabilir. Bu entegrasyon, projelerinizin daha verimli ve etkili bir şekilde çalışmasını sağlar.

Eğer Laravel kullanıyorsanız ve projelerinizde verimliliği artırmak istiyorsanız, yapay zeka entegrasyonunu kesinlikle göz önünde bulundurmalısınız. Geliştirdiğiniz projelere AI eklemek, sizi sektördeki diğer geliştiricilerden bir adım öne çıkaracaktır.

İlgili Yazılar

Benzer konularda diğer yazılarımız

Yapay Zeka ile Web Tasarımında Devrim: Otomatikleştirilmiş UX/UI Tasarım Süreçleri Nasıl Oluşturulur?

---**Yapay Zeka ile Web Tasarımında Devrim: Otomatikleştirilmiş UX/UI Tasarım Süreçleri Nasıl Oluşturulur?**Web tasarımı, son yıllarda büyük bir dönüşüm geçiriyor. Artık sadece görsel açıdan değil, aynı zamanda işlevsellik ve kullanıcı deneyimi açısından...

PHP’de 'Memory Limit Exceeded' Hatası Nasıl Aşılır? Yüksek Trafikli Web Siteleri İçin Pratik Çözümler

PHP ile web geliştiren herkes, bir noktada "Memory Limit Exceeded" hatası ile karşılaşmıştır. Bu hata, özellikle yüksek trafikli sitelerde oldukça can sıkıcı olabilir. Ancak, bu hatanın neden meydana geldiğini ve nasıl etkili bir şekilde çözebileceğinizi...

Memcached Windows'ta Nasıl Kurulur? Adım Adım Kılavuz

Memcached, web uygulamalarını hızlandıran güçlü bir bellek içi veri deposudur. Veritabanı sorgularını hızlandırmak için kullanılan bu sistem, büyük veri ve yoğun trafikle başa çıkmanızı sağlar. Ancak, belki de en zor kısım, Memcached'in Windows'ta nasıl...

Yapay Zeka ile Kod Yazmanın Geleceği: Makine Öğrenmesi ve Otomatik Programlama Arasındaki Farklar

Yapay zeka (YZ) ve makine öğrenmesi (MO) günümüzde yazılım geliştirme dünyasında devrim yaratmaya başladı. Geçmişte, yazılımlar insanlar tarafından tek tek satırlar halinde yazılırken, şimdi bu süreci otomatikleştiren ve hızlandıran araçlar ortaya çıkıyor....

Web Siteniz Yavaş Mı? Hızlandırmak İçin 10 Etkili Yöntem ve İpuçları

Web sitenizin hızının, kullanıcı deneyimi üzerinde ne kadar etkili olduğunu düşündünüz mü? Eğer siteniz yavaşsa, ziyaretçilerinizin sabır sınırlarını zorlayabilir ve sonuçta sitenizi terk etmelerine neden olabilir. Bu da, hem kullanıcı kaybına hem de...

Yapay Zeka ile Zaman Yönetimi: Verimli Çalışma İçin Teknolojik Çözümler

Zaman, hayatımızın en değerli kaynağıdır. Hepimiz daha verimli olmanın yollarını arıyoruz, değil mi? İşte tam bu noktada, yapay zeka (AI) devreye giriyor. Teknolojinin hızla ilerlemesiyle birlikte, iş yapış şekillerimizi dönüştüren yeni araçlar ve çözümler...